SPOKANE (AP) — A Yakima County judge has blocked an effort to recall Spokane Mayor David Condon.

Superior Court Judge Blaine Gibson on Tuesday threw out all the allegations against Condon.

A petition filed by Spokane accountant David Green contended that Condon delayed the release of public records regarding the firing of former police chief Frank Straub until after his re-election last November.

It also contended that Condon violated city policies in his handling of sexual harassment claims made by former police spokeswoman Monique Cotton against Straub.

The petition also criticized the mayor for appointing a new chief without submitting the pick to the City Council.

The only Spokane mayor to be recalled was the late Jim West in 2005.

Green has 15 days to appeal directly to the state Supreme Court.
